Wednesday exploded onto the world in 2022, becoming one of the biggest and the third most-watched shows on the streaming platform. It nearly edged out Stranger Things Season 4 to take #2 all-time. Netflix took time to announce it but has renewed the Addams Family reboot for an additional season. However, one of its biggest stars has reportedly been written out of the show stemming from sexual assault allegations.

Wednesday follows Wednesday Addams (Jenna Ortega), as she is ripped from public school for defending her brother with the usage of piranhas and is thrust into the world of Nevermore Academy. The private school is for gifted and less-than-normal students. Some are part werewolves, some can sing a siren song to control whoever they please, and others morph into hideous, Hyde-like creatures.
Wednesday begins to meet many of her classmates, though some are instantly her enemies, as her deadpan and cold demeanor can be off-putting. She also begins to gain favor with two boys, one from the school and the other perceived as part of the regular townsfolk. One such boy from the academy is Xavier Thorpe, played by Percy Hynes White.
